When we talk about 1 kg in oz, we are usually looking for the international avoirdupois ounce. That's the one used in the United States and the UK for most everyday items. The math is relatively straightforward but annoying to do in your head. One kilogram equals approximately 35.274 ounces.

The Math Behind the 1 kg in oz Conversion

Why that specific, messy decimal? It’s because the kilogram is a base unit of the International System of Units (SI), defined by the Planck constant, while the ounce is a leftover from a chaotic history of Roman weights and medieval trade agreements.

To be precise, 1 kilogram is exactly 1,000 grams. One ounce is defined as exactly 28.349523125 grams. When you divide 1,000 by 28.3495, you get that 35.27 number. Most people just round it to 35.3 and call it a day. But if you are a jeweler, a pharmacist, or a particularly neurotic pastry chef, those extra decimal places represent the difference between success and a very expensive mistake.

Back in the day, an "ounce" could mean anything. You had the Tower ounce, the Maria Theresa ounce, and the Dutch troy ounce. It wasn't until the 1959 International Yard and Pound Agreement that the US and the Commonwealth countries finally sat down and agreed that a pound is exactly 0.45359237 kilograms. Since there are 16 ounces in a pound, that gave us our modern conversion for 1 kg in oz.

Wait, Is It a Fluid Ounce?

This is where people get tripped up and ruin their dinner. A kilogram is a measure of mass (weight, for those of us not on the moon). An ounce can be a measure of mass, but a "fluid ounce" is a measure of volume.

If you are trying to convert 1 kg in oz for water, you’re in luck. One kilogram of water is exactly one liter. One liter of water is about 33.8 fluid ounces. Notice the difference? 35.27 vs 33.8. If you use a measuring cup meant for liquids to measure out a kilogram of dry flour, you are going to end up with a mess. Flour is less dense than water. A kilogram of feathers would fill a literal backyard, while a kilogram of lead would fit in your pocket.

Always check your units. Mass is not volume.

The Troy Ounce Trap

Let’s say you’re lucky enough to own a kilogram of gold. Don't use the 35.27 conversion. Seriously.

Precious metals are measured in Troy ounces. A Troy ounce is heavier than a standard (avoirdupois) ounce.

  • 1 standard ounce = 28.35 grams
  • 1 Troy ounce = 31.10 grams

If you have 1 kg in oz of gold, you actually have about 32.15 Troy ounces. If you sell that gold thinking you have 35.27 ounces, you’re going to be very disappointed when the dealer gives you a lower quote. The Evolution of the Kilogram

We used to have a physical object called "Le Grand K." It was a cylinder of platinum-iridium kept in a vault in France. That hunk of metal was the kilogram. Every scale in the world was technically calibrated to match it.

The problem? It was losing weight.

Over decades, Le Grand K lost about 50 micrograms—roughly the weight of a fingerprint. This drove scientists crazy. If the definition of a kilogram changed, then the calculation for 1 kg in oz technically shifted too, even if by a microscopic amount.

In 2019, the world changed the definition. Now, the kilogram is tied to the Planck constant. It's based on the laws of physics, not a piece of metal in a jar. This means that 1 kg is now "forever" stable. Your conversion to 35.274 ounces will be just as accurate 1,000 years from now as it is today.

Practical Steps for Accurate Conversion

If you're tired of Googling "1 kg in oz" every time you’re in the middle of a project, there are a few ways to handle this like a pro.

  1. Buy a Dual-Unit Scale: Honestly, this is the easiest fix. Any decent digital scale under $20 has a "unit" button. Stop doing math. Just press the button.
  2. The 2.2 Rule: If you don't need to be perfect, remember that 1 kg is about 2.2 pounds. Multiply 2.2 by 16 (the ounces in a pound).
  3. Use the 35.3 Shortcut: For cooking, 35.3 is the magic number. It’s close enough that the humidity in your kitchen will have a bigger impact on the recipe than your rounding error.
  4. Check the "Net Weight": If you are buying imported goods, look at the bottom of the package. Law requires most countries to list both grams/kilograms and ounces/pounds. It’s a great way to double-check your intuition.

A Quick Reference for Common Weights

To give you a better sense of how these weights scale, consider these common conversions you’ll run into:

  • 500 grams (0.5 kg): 17.63 oz. This is your standard "pint" of weight.
  • 1 kg: 35.27 oz. The gold standard for mid-sized shipping.
  • 2 kg: 70.54 oz. Roughly the weight of a standard brick.
  • 5 kg: 176.37 oz. A common size for a large bag of rice or flour.
